Little Buckets Kinross recognises and respects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ples as the First Peoples of Australia. They are the Traditional Custodians of the Land on which our early childhood services sits and the children play, grow, and learn on. We acknowledge and pay respect to Elders, past and present and emerging. Here at Little Buckets Kinross, we aim to respectfully embed Aboriginal and Tores Strait Islander peoples’ perspectives and histories into our centre Early Learning Program, where the staff, children and parents have input in our reconciliation journey and deepen our knowledge as part of respect for our country and people.
